SuperSnes9x v1.63.21 has been released. This portable emulator for the Super Nintendo Entertainment System (TM) is based on Snes9x and serves as an unofficial fork of the original Snes9x project.
SuperSnes9x Highlights:
Kaillera Server/Client
RetroAchievements
S-PPU Sprite/Tile/Tiles viewers
Support for multiple controllers
SDL Compatibility
Run-Ahead Functionality
Color Correction Feature
Advanced Cheat Search / Cheat Editor
SuperSnes9x Update Log:
Game Boy Color Core:
Introduced Game Boy Color emulation with full CGB support in the SGB core.
CGB-mode rendering, improved palette/color management, and automatic CGB loading for CGB cartridges.
Corrected CGB rendering in the SGB BIOS and refined cartridge routing to ensure GB/GBC/SGB titles run correctly.
Game Boy:
New PPU debugger viewers â including GB tile viewer, tilemap viewer, and sprite/OAM viewer, featuring per-layer toggles.
S-PPU and GB-PPU viewer menus are now context-sensitive based on loaded ROMs.
MBC1 multicart (MBC1M) support added â BANK2<<4 game-slot selection enables multicarts like “Mortal Kombat & Mortal Kombat II” to boot into the correct game bank.
APU DAC DC-bias modeling implemented â accurately models the DAC’s DC bias to prevent issues with master-volume-driven PCM voices (NR50 PCM + CH4 carrier) being cut off.
Resolved issues with partial playback of digitized voices (e.g., Bart Simpson voice samples).
Square-channel duty reset on trigger (master c0d9941) fixes silent/garbled PCM voice jingles on the Telefang title screen by resetting square duty position on channel trigger.
Options to toggle Sprites/Background/Window layers are available.
Win32:
Added a controller image switcher â USA / Euro-Japanese controller image selector within the Input Config dialog, activated by right-clicking the image.
Input configuration multi-bind fixes address glitches in the input configuration dialog for multi-bind/single-bind setups.
Libretro
Updated libretro .dll to incorporate the latest fixes.
